Dax Kelson wrote: > I'm looking a purchasing a dozen computers with the Soyo SY-K7V Dragon > Plus motherboard. It has the KT266A chipset. > > My question is Linux support for the onboard ethernet and sound. I've > googled all over and haven't come up with a definitive answer. > > They are described as "VIA 10/100 Ethernet" and "CMI 8738 Audio chip". CMI 8738 has a driver in the current kernel. As for VIA 10/100 Ethernet, I dunno... Maybe the via-rhine would work ? Not sure, though...
